Cell Culture Monitoring Biosensors: An Informational Overview
Introduction
Cell culture monitoring biosensors are tools used in biological research and biotechnology to observe and measure the health, behavior, and environment of living cells grown in laboratory conditions. These devices help scientists gather real-time data on cell cultures without disrupting or harming the cells, making them valuable for research, drug development, and bioprocessing.
What Biosensors Are
A biosensor is a device that detects biological information and converts it into measurable signals. In cell culture monitoring, biosensors track parameters such as temperature, pH, oxygen levels, glucose concentration, and metabolic activity. By providing continuous feedback, these sensors help researchers understand how cells respond to various conditions.
